TODAY is putting a new spin on an old classic with the launch of the TODAY Book Club- a unique discussion series connecting book lovers with engaging reads from both up-and-coming new authors to some of their seasoned favorites.

Revamping the book club experience for the digital age, the TODAY Book Club will meet regularly using Google Hangouts, where members can directly connect and interact with the TODAY team, the featured author and other special fans who share a passion for great books.

As was announced on the show this morning, the TODAY Book Club is kicking off with the highly-anticipated novel The Bone Season, available in stores on Tuesday, August 20th. Natalie Morales will host the first TODAY Book Club Google Hangout on Monday, September 16thwith the novel's 21-year-old author, Samantha Shannon-who wrote the book while attending college at Oxford University. The Bone Season is Shannon's riveting first installment in a seven-part fantasy series set in a dystopian futuristic London where the story's clairvoyant heroine struggles against a totalitarian government and its Supernatural overlords.

TODAY Book Club members will have the opportunity to connect with Shannon directly about her highly buzzed-about debut during the Google Hangout. Readers can go to TODAY.com/BookClub now to sign up for the Google Hangout and the TODAY Book Club newsletter to keep up with the club community. In addition, members can read an exclusive excerpt of The Bone Season on TODAY.com, as well as find the latest author and book news, must-read lists, giveaways and more.

Part of a continuing series, the TODAY Book Club team will choose unique books across every major genre, and selections will be announced on TODAY a few weeks in advance of each of the Google Hangout discussions. All TODAY fans are invited to participate and will be able to sign up for these special discussions upon each announcement of a new book selection. TODAY Book Club discussions will be archived and available to replay on demand at TODAY.com/BookClub.

The Bone Season is published by Bloomsbury and film rights for the book have been optioned by The Imaginarium Studios.
